Output 286203088bde6872a107c76bbaa0c75463d52bf8ffe5a838fc64af1c104abf7c:2

value
2560772
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 964cd9320d9ab223dc49d2e195cc24fd81fe16c0 OP_EQUALVERIFY OP_CHECKSIG
address
1EhiRJC4mWcnMEZ2u3yoyhGuEhPUJEqMNz
transaction
286203088bde6872a107c76bbaa0c75463d52bf8ffe5a838fc64af1c104abf7c
spent
true